The conversion efficiency of silicon photovoltaic cells is inversely proportional to its temperature. This article led to the hybrid photovoltaic/thermal (PV/T) solar systems. That is, the fluid channel installed on the back of the battery can extraction the heat away in order to reduce the battery temperature.The text introduces the operating principle and system model of two primary models of photovoltaic thermal systems: PV?T water systems and PV?T air systems. By comparing the calculation results, we can draw the conclusion that the PV/T systems have the advantage on the suppression of temperature rise. In this paper, I made two cooling methods of photovoltaic template, selected a more reasonable plan to build test-bed for experimental research, and got the relationship between the template temperature and solar radiation intensity,light duration,the rate of water flow,temperature. Using these data I drew charts. By analyzing, concluded that in different light conditions, the effect extent of various factors on temperature.
